Re: questions about rx7
where do you live? maybe someone here knows a near by rotary shop.
it has to be 88-91 like said before, if it has the round tail lights then its 89-91, if not then its 88(obviously) also if it has a black line around it then its an 88(unless the car is black then you can't tell that way) if the line is the same color as the body then its an 89-91 oh and 86-88 is an S4 89-91 is an S5.... just so you know and that how stuff works web page is awesome, look through it like 80 billion times and you should have it down pretty good
